Abstract

An electrical connector system may include a center housing that defines a plurality of first electrical contact channels on a first side face of the center housing and a plurality of second electrical contact channels on a second side face of the center housing. A first array of electrical contacts is positioned substantially within the plurality of first electrical contact channels on the first side face of the center housing. A second array of electrical contacts is positioned substantially within the plurality of second electrical contact channels on the second side face of the center housing. The first array of electrical contacts is paired with a third array of electrical contacts to form a first plurality of differential pairs of electrical contacts. The second array of electrical contacts is paired with a fourth array of electrical contacts to form a second plurality of differential pairs of electrical contacts.
